The following dotplot shows the number of strokes taken by 20 professional golfers competing at an 18-hole golf course.B? or E?

I'm not sure if it would be considered categorical or continuous? It is definitely quantitive.The figure presents a dotplot titled Number of Strokes, and the numbers 62 through 70 are indicated, in increments of 1. The dotplot contains 20 data points. The data are as follows. 62 strokes, 0 golfers. 63 strokes, 0 golfers. 64 strokes, 2 golfers. 65 strokes, 4 golfers. 66 strokes, 2 golfers. 67 strokes, 6 golfers. 68 strokes, 3 golfers. 69 strokes, 3 golfers. 70 strokes, 0 golfers.Which of the following best describes the type of variable represented in the dotplot?A??A. Quantitative and discreteB. Quantitative and continuousC. Categorical and discreteD. Categorical and continuousE. Quantitative and categorical
